Find out exactly what your credit score is

The impact of bad credit on your life can be devastating. You can get denied for a home loan, an auto loan, or worse yet be approved for credit at extremely high rates of interest. The good news is that you can be proactive when managing your credit. Delinquent accounts are typically expunged within 7 years. And if you filed chapter 7 bankruptcy, you would have to wait 10 years for that to be removed from your credit report. For these reasons, you don’t necessarily want to wait an inordinate amount of time before you correct your credit problems. Luckily, the US credit bureaus provide free credit reports once a year. Before you do anything, check your credit reports! You will see any judgments against you, any delinquent accounts, and any credit queries made against your Social Security number.  You won’t be able to find your exact credit score, but you will get an idea of where your credit situation stands.

When you’re combating bad debts, it’s important to understand when judgments against you were filed. The date of the filing is day 1 and the clock keeps ticking from there. Delinquency is a more complex issue to tackle, but there are rules to help clients understand how to stay abreast of dates and debts. And when you’re checking your free annual credit reports, be advised that your Experian report will differ from your TransUnion report and that will differ from your Equifax report.

How to Make Your Bad Credit Problems Go Away – Final Thoughts

Your free annual credit reports do not tell you what your credit score is, you must pay for that separately. Nonetheless, these are important resources for you to use to understand what items you’ll have to focus on. If you find any discrepancies in your credit report, contact the creditor that is reporting the issue and make sure you get evidence to substantiate why you are disputing information on your credit report. Online disputes of discrepancies are easily done and can only a matter of a couple of days to get resolved. You may have to resort to the traditional letter writing option if you don’t get any feedback.
